Tera Manzil Temple

Tera Manzil Temple, also known as Trayambakeshwar Temple, is a famous landmark in Rishikesh, Uttarakhand, India. The name “Tera Manzil” translates to “Thirteen Storeys” in Hindi, reflecting the thirteen levels of this unique temple. It’s located on the banks of the holy Ganges River and is a prominent place for both religious worship and tourism.

Tera Manzil Temple In Rishikesh

The Tera Manzil temple is dedicated to Lord Shiva and attracts devotees and tourists alike due to its architecture, spiritual significance, and panoramic views of the surrounding area from its upper floors. It’s a place where people come to worship, meditate, and soak in the serene atmosphere.The thirteen floors of the temple house various deities, and each level holds its significance.
The vibrant atmosphere around the temple, especially during religious festivals like Mahashivratri, draws devotees from different parts of the country who come here to seek blessings and immerse themselves in the spiritual aura.

How To Reach Tera Manzil Temple

By Road

From Rishikesh Bus Stand: The temple is around 3 kilometers away from the Rishikesh Bus Stand. You can hire a taxi, auto-rickshaw, or take a local bus to reach the temple.

By Air

From Dehradun Airport: If you’re arriving by air, you can book a taxi or cab from the Jolly Grant Airport in Dehradun, which is the nearest airport to Rishikesh. The distance between the airport and the temple is approximately 21 kilometers.

By Railway

From Rishikesh Railway Station: If you’re coming by train, the Rishikesh Railway Station is around 6 kilometers away from the Temple. You can take a taxi, auto-rickshaw, or a bus from the station to reach the temple.
